Accommodations & Facilities

Common facilities for use by all our guests include:

  • A screened fish cleaning hut with packaging supplies
  • Large freezers for your take-home catch
  • A shower room with hot water in all cabins
  • Facilities to recharge batteries for your electronic equipment

Accommodations

Although basic, all our cabins provide for good, comfortable and very clean accommodations for a minimum of 4 guests (some accommodate 6 guests) and are fully equipped for basic housekeeping.  Each cabin features:

  • Propane refrigerator, stove, and lights
  • Indoor washroom including stand-up shower with hot water
  • Fully equipped kitchen – dishes, cutlery, pots and pans, glasses, etc.
  • we also recommend you bring sleeping bags
  • Running cold water (source of water is a mountain creek and is not treated or tested for potability – we recommend you bring your own supply of drinking water)
  • A sofa and chairs, dining table
  • A wood stove - heating wood is supplied
  • A large deck with propane BBQ
  • A private dock
  • A wall-mounted 42”x42” satellite photo of the lake marking the Outfitters, fishing spots & hunting trails
  • We supply the dish soap, dish towels, toilet tissue, and garbage bags.

 

Here is a list of things you should bring or might want to bring along for your comfort:

  • Light sleeping bags
  • Sheets and pillow case
  • Drinking water
  • Personal towels and toiletries
  • Bug spray
  • Flashlight and batteries
  • Paper towel and/or facial tissues
  • Rain gear and spare footwear
  • Bait for fishing: minnows, worms, leaches (only on occasion do we carry a small supply,  but you should check with us first)
  • Correctly sized life jackets for children.
  • And of course your camera with lots of film.

Remember that we do not have electricity or continuous running generators at our camps.  We do run a generator for a few hours in the morning and then a few hours in the evening to provide outdoor lighting around the camps and the fish cleaning house, power to recharge batteries, and to maintain the contents (your catch) of our freezers… well… frozen.
